Analysis of the Continuity of Outpatient among Adult Patients with hypertension and its Influential Factors in Korea (우리나라 성인 고혈압환자의 외래진료 지속성과 이에 영향을 미치는 요인 분석)

  • The administration data of the national health insurance and health insurance bills were utilized in this study. The data of 485,953 patients who were at the age of 30 and up and used the out-patient departments of every medical institution located in some regions involving two southern and northern provinces once or more during a 184-day period from July to December, 2008. As a result of analyzing their Continuity of Ambulatory Care and factors affecting it, the following findings were given: The continuity of ambulatory care among the adult patients with hypertension in our country turned out to be on a high level(MMCI $0.96{\pm}0.13$, MFPC $0.96{\pm}0.12$). Given examining the outpatient medical-cure continuity level according to index, the averagely medical-cure continuity level was calculated to be high level with MMCI, $0.96{\pm}0.13$, and MFPC $0.96{\pm}0.12$. Thus, the tendency of visiting only one medical provider was high. The findings of the study illustrated that the average continuity of ambulatory care among the adult patients with hypertension in our country was on a high level, and it seemed that special care should be provided to patients with a low-level continuity of ambulatory care, such as women and elderly people aged 64 and over. Preference and Service Satisfaction of Campsite Visitors - Focus on Wolaksan.Sokrisan National Park - (야영장 이용객의 선호요인과 이용 만족도 - 월악산.속리산국립공원을 중심으로 -)

  • The purpose of this study is to analyze visitor preferences and the degree of service satisfaction for campsites and investigate factors that influence visitor satisfaction so that the study may provide proper data needed to build and operate campsites. The results are as follows. 1. It was found that men use campsites more frequently than women. Campsites are most often used by those in their thirties, the highest percentage out of all the age groups. Relaxation proved to be the main purpose for using campsites. It was also found that usually 2 to 4 people use a campsite at a time, the highest percentage as well. 2. The factor-analysis of 13 items related to campsite satisfaction can be divided into facilities, psychological factors, the surrounding-environment and access. 3. It was found that the satisfaction of lavatories has the most influence in the facilities factor. The satisfaction on the intention to revisit has the most influence in the psychological factor. The landscape element has the most influence in regards to the surrounding-environment and the guidance and sign system has the most influence in the access factor. 4. It was found that the factors that most influence overall satisfaction are facilities factor, psychological factors and the surrounding environment, in that order.

A Comparative Study on DMFS, DMFT and FS-T Indexes in the Korean Elderly (한국 노인의 DMFS, DMFT 지수와 FS-T 지수의 비교 연구)

  • The purpose of this study was to examine the demographic characteristics, oral health awareness and oral health behavior of 1,356 Korean senior citizens based on the fourth raw materials of the 2008 national health and nutrition survey, and to analyze their DMFS, DMFT and FS-T indexes, which were oral health indicators. The findings of the study were as follows: 1. The mean DMFS index of the Korean senior citizens was 26.62, and their average DMFT index was 6.76. Their mean FS-T index was 21.51. 2. Out of the demographic characteristics of the Korean elderly people, education made statistically significant differences to the DMFS(p<0.05) and FS-T(p<0.001) indexes, and whether they worked or not made statistically significant differences to the DMFT(p<0.01), DMFS(0.001) and FS-T(0.001) indexes. There were no significant gaps according to gender, age and presence or absence of a spouse. 3. The oral health awareness of the Korean senior citizens(subjective oral health status, whether to need a dental treatment, concern for oral health and mastication) had no statistically significant relationship to their DMFS, DMFT and FS-T indexes. 4. Among the oral health behaviors of the Korean elderly people, whether they got a dental checkup over the past year made statistically significant differences to the DMFT(p<0.01), DMFS(p<0.001) and FS-T (p<0.001) indexes, and there were statistically significant gaps in the DMFT(p<0.010, FS-T(p<0.01) and DMFS(p<0.001) indexes according to yesterday's toothbrushing frequency. The time when they went to a dentist made a significant difference to the FS-T(p<0.01) index only.

Geographical Characteristics and Patients' Determinants of Online Referrals : A Case Study of Choongbook, Korea (온라인 협진에 대한 지리적 특성과 환자의 결정에 관한 연구 : 충청북도 사례를 중심으로)

  • This study employs qualitative approaches to examining geographical characteristics and patients' determinants of online referrals in terms of regionalization. In this light, I conducted interviews with 20 patients receiving online referrals in Choongbook, Korea, and investigated their behaviors regarding these referrals between July and August 2009. I found that many patients who suffered from various levels of illness preferred tertiary care centers outside of Choongbook and did not enjoy their experience with the local medical institutions as the online referral service sites. This result might be because patients choose online referrals for psychological considerations such as quality and level of health care services, personal stakes in online referral service sites, acceptability and credibility of good tertiary care centers, and easy access to and use of medical institutions. Meanwhile, immediate benefits with regard to the technological value of online referrals, such as convenience, utility, and original purpose associated with regionalization, did not influence patients' decision-making. Therefore, the social and public networks affiliated with online referrals plus the effect of Korean medical laws play hostage to private decisions made by citizens, who prefer high-level medical institutions. Accordingly, the technological contribution of online referrals does not halt the outflow of patients from local, tertiary care centers. Especially, the existing health care system and patients' behaviors are deeply related to referrals in the online system. To protect regionalization, the improvement of health care services from the present state of affairs is required.

Construction of High-Speed Railway Based Living Zone Considering High-order Service Accessibility: focused on comparison between Chungcheong, Yeongnam, Honam and Gangwon Region (고차 서비스 접근성을 고려한 고속철도 연계형 생활권 구축에 관한 연구 -충청권, 영남권, 호남권, 강원권 비교를 중심으로-)

  • In a situation where population decline is intensifying, the decline of local mid-small sized cities is emerging as a social problem. The decline will increase the difficulty of supplying demand-based living services. Therefore, increasing accessibility to living services is important for quality of life. With this background, the purpose of this study is to derive living zones that can use high-order services in metropolitan cities through high-speed railway. To this end, the behaviors of residents in mid-small sized cities were investigated through a questionnaire, and living zones and vulnerable areas were derived through a GIS analysis. The results of the study are summarized as follows. First, most of the residents had experience using cultural, medical, shopping, and educational services in metropolitan cities. Second, the time required to visit a metropolitan city for the use of higher-order services was about 2 hours, and the desired time was about 50 minutes. Third, when accessibility is improved, the willingness to use the higher-order service of the metropolitan city is high. Fourth, many regions have been derived as living zones where services of metropolitan cities can be used through high-speed rail. Lastly, the major vulnerable areas were found to be the northern area of the Gangwon region, the northern area of the Yeongnam region, the west coast of Chungnam, and the border area of Jeonnam and Gyeongnam.
